基于分布式神经网络的变压器励磁涌流鉴别的研究

摘    要:针对目前变压器保护中普遍采用的利用二次谐波原理识别变压器励磁涌流存在的缺陷,提出利用分布式人工神经网络实现基于半波叠加原理鉴别励磁涌流的新方案。经仿真实验,该方案能准确地判别出变压器内部故障和励磁涌流,不受系统谐波影响,具有很高的可靠性。

关 键 词:励磁涌流  相电流差  人工神经网络(ANN)

Study of Identification of the Inrush Based on Distributed Artificial Neural Network

Abstract:Aimed at the disadvantages of second harmonic restraint, a new method is presented in this paper to distinguish inrush current. The new method is based on the theory of half-circle-added and realized by distributed Artificial Neural Network. The simulation tests show that the new method can judge correctly the transformer's inrush current and internal fault. The method can not affected by the harmonic and has good reliability.
Keywords:inrush current  phase differential current  Artificial Neural Network
